Title: FISH AND GAME, WILD BIRDS AND ANIMALS
Section: Failure to turn over moneys by clerk, warden or magistrate; misdemeanor
Statute: 23:3-15
Statute Text
A county or municipal clerk or an agent who fails to turn over any moneys collected for licenses, and a magistrate who fails to turn over any moneys collected as a penalty, at the time and in the manner required by law, shall be guilty of a misdemeanor.
Amended by L.1947, c. 159, p. 713, s. 8; L.1951, c. 226, p. 802, s. 12, eff. Jan. 1, 1952.
